Repair Procedures: Replacement

  1. Loosen the wheel nuts slightly.

    Raise the vehicle, and make sure it is securely supported.

  2. Remove the front wheel and tire (A) from front hub.

    Tightening torque: 

    88.3 ~ 107.9 N.m (9.0 ~ 11.0 kgf.m, 65.1 ~ 79.6 lb-ft)

    Fig 1: Front Wheel And Tire With Wheel Nuts
    G10726776Courtesy of KIA MOTORS AMERICA, INC.
    CAUTION: Be careful not to damage to the hub bolts when removing the front wheel and tire (A).
  3. Loosen the guide rod bolt (B) and pivot the caliper (A) up out of the way.

    Tightening torque: 

    21.6 ~ 31.4 N.m (2.2 ~ 3.2 kgf.m, 15.9 ~ 23.1 lb-ft)

    Fig 2: Caliper And Guide Rod Bolt
    G10726777Courtesy of KIA MOTORS AMERICA, INC.
  4. Remove the brake pads (A).
    Fig 3: Brake Pads
    G10726778Courtesy of KIA MOTORS AMERICA, INC.
  5. Remove the brake caliper mounting bolts (A), and then place the brake caliper assembly (B) with wire.

    Tightening torque: 

    78.4 ~ 98.0 N.m (8.0 ~ 10.0 kgf.m, 57.8 ~ 72.3 lb-ft)

    Fig 4: Brake Caliper Mounting Bolts
    G10726779Courtesy of KIA MOTORS AMERICA, INC.
    Fig 5: Brake Caliper Assembly
    G10726780Courtesy of KIA MOTORS AMERICA, INC.
  6. Loosen the front brake disc mount screw (B) and then remove the front brake disc (A).

    Tightening torque: 

    4.9 ~ 5.9 N.m (0.5 ~ 0.6 kgf.m, 3.6 ~ 4.3 lb-ft)

    Fig 6: Front Brake Disc By Loosening Front Brake Disc Mount Screw
    G10726781Courtesy of KIA MOTORS AMERICA, INC.
  7. Remove driveshaft nut (A) from the front hub.

    Tightening torque: 

    274.6 ~ 294.2 N.m (28.0 ~ 30.0 Kgf.m, 202.5 ~ 217.0 lb-ft)

    Fig 7: Removing Driveshaft Nut From Front Hub
    G10726782Courtesy of KIA MOTORS AMERICA, INC.
    CAUTION:
    • The driveshaft lock nut should be replaced with new ones.
    • After installation driveshaft lock nut, stake the lock nut using a chisel and hammer as shown in the illustration below.
    Fig 8: Staking Lock Nut Using Chisel And Hammer
    G10726783Courtesy of KIA MOTORS AMERICA, INC.
  8. Remove the tie rod end ball joint (C) from the knuckle by using the SST (09568-34000).
    1. Remove the split pin (A).
    2. Remove the castle nut (B).
    3. Use the SST (09568-34000).

      Tightening torque: 

      23.5 ~ 33.3N.m (2.4 ~ 3.4kgf.m, 19.4 ~ 24.6lb-ft)

      Fig 9: End Ball Joint, Castle Nut And Split Pin
      G10726784Courtesy of KIA MOTORS AMERICA, INC.
      Fig 10: Tie Rod End Ball Joint From Knuckle Using SST (09568-34000)
      G10726785Courtesy of KIA MOTORS AMERICA, INC.
      CAUTION:
      • When using SST, be sure not to damage the dust cover of lower arm ball joint.
      • Keep SST tied to the car because there is arisk of injury by dropping the SST during removal of the lower arm ball joint.
      • The peripheral parts may be damaged when removing the lower arm ball joint with a general tool such as lever, so be sure to use SST.
  9. Loosen the mount bolt and then remove the wheel speed sensor (A) from knuckle.

    Tightening torque: 

    6.8 ~ 10.7 N.m (0.7 ~ 1.1 kgf.m, 5.0 ~ 7.9 lb-ft)

    Fig 11: Wheel Speed Sensor From Knuckle By Loosening Mount Bolt
    G10726786Courtesy of KIA MOTORS AMERICA, INC.
  10. Loosen the bolt & nut and then remove the lower arm (A).

    Tightening torque: 

    58.8 ~ 70.6 N.m (6.0 ~ 7.2 kgf.m, 43.4 ~ 52.1 lb-ft)

    Fig 12: Lower Arm
    G10726787Courtesy of KIA MOTORS AMERICA, INC.
  11. Disconnect the driveshaft (A) from the front hub assembly.
    Fig 13: Driveshaft
    G10726788Courtesy of KIA MOTORS AMERICA, INC.
  12. Loosen the strut mounting bolts (A) and then remove the knuckle assembly (B).

    Tightening torque: 

    137.3 ~ 156.9 N.m (14.0 ~ 16.0 kgf.m, 101.3 ~ 115.7 lb-ft)

    Fig 14: Knuckle Assembly By Loosening Strut Mounting Bolts
    G10726789Courtesy of KIA MOTORS AMERICA, INC.
